The Essentials of Web Development and Its Growing Impact

Web development is the cornerstone of the digital world, driving the creation and functionality of the websites and applications we interact with every day. As the internet continues to evolve, web development has become an essential skill set, impacting everything from business operations to social interactions. Whether it’s a simple personal blog or a complex e-commerce platform, web development encompasses the tools, techniques, and processes needed to bring an idea to life in the digital space. It involves creating, designing, and maintaining websites that are not only functional but also appealing and user-friendly.

At the core of web development are three main areas: front-end development, back-end development, and full-stack development. Front-end development focuses on what users see and interact with when they visit a website. It involves designing the user interface and ensuring the website is visually appealing and easy to navigate. Front-end developers use languages such as HTML, CSS, and JavaScript to create the structure, style, and interactive elements of a website. The goal is to deliver an enjoyable experience for the user while ensuring that the website functions well on different devices, from desktop computers to smartphones.

On the other hand, back-end development is concerned with the behind-the-scenes functionality of a website. This involves working with databases, servers, and application logic to ensure that data is processed and delivered to the front-end efficiently. Back-end developers use programming languages like Python, Ruby, Java, or PHP, and frameworks http://www.erloesergemeinde-moabit.de/ such as Django or Express to build the systems that support a website’s functionality. These developers focus on creating secure, scalable, and reliable systems that process user requests and handle large amounts of data.

Full-stack development combines both front-end and back-end development, allowing developers to manage all aspects of a website. Full-stack developers have expertise in both client-side and server-side development, making them highly versatile and capable of building complete web applications. With their broad skill set, full-stack developers can work across the entire development process, from designing user interfaces to managing databases and server infrastructure.

The tools and technologies available to web developers have advanced significantly in recent years. Modern frameworks like React, Angular, and Vue.js have streamlined front-end development, making it easier to build dynamic, interactive websites and applications. On the back-end, technologies like Node.js and cloud computing have revolutionized the way developers build and deploy applications, allowing for faster and more scalable web development. These innovations have led to more sophisticated and feature-rich web experiences, enabling businesses to provide better services to their customers and create more engaging content.

With the growing reliance on digital platforms, the demand for web development professionals is higher than ever. Web developers are needed in almost every industry, from tech startups to established corporations, making web development a highly sought-after career. The industry is constantly evolving, requiring developers to stay up to date with the latest technologies, tools, and trends to remain competitive. As more businesses and individuals turn to the web to communicate, buy, and sell, web development will continue to play a crucial role in shaping the future of the digital world.

In conclusion, web development is a rapidly growing and integral field that drives innovation in the digital space. It is responsible for the functionality and design of the websites and applications that are at the center of modern life. Whether through front-end design, back-end systems, or full-stack development, web developers are at the forefront of creating the digital experiences we use every day. With the constant advancement of technology, the web development industry will continue to evolve, creating new opportunities for developers and expanding the possibilities of what can be achieved on the web.